08/09/2011, 17:53
|
| | Fecha de Ingreso: agosto-2010
Mensajes: 52
Antigüedad: 14 años, 3 meses Puntos: 12 | |
Respuesta: Validar datos de TextBox contra SQL usando AJAX Korreca
Gracias
ya quedó
Saludos
Mas o menos así quedo ..para que se den una idea.
-------------------------------------------------------------------
DATOS DE ENTRADA EN EL TEXTBOX
<asp:TextBox
ID = "TextBox2"
runat = "server"
onblur = "ValidaDato(this.value);"
>
</asp:TextBox>
PROCESO. CON ESTE CONTROL SE LLAMA AL WEBSERVICE Y ESTE ES LLAMADO DESDDE LA FUNCION DE JAVA SCRIPT
<cc1:DynamicPopulateExtender
ID = "DynamicPopulateExtender1"
runat = "server"
TargetControlID = "Label1"
ServiceMethod = "ValidaDato"
UpdatingCssClass= "dynamicPopulate_Updating"
>
</cc1:DynamicPopulateExtender>
SALIDA: EN ESTE LABEL SE PONE EL RESULTADO DEL WEBSERVICE
<asp:Label
ID="Label1"
runat="server"
Text="Label"
>
</asp:Label>
FUNCION DE JABA QUE LLAMA A SU VEZ A DynamicPopulateExtender1 CON EL PARAMETRO DE ENTRADA DEL TEXTBOX
function ValidaDato(value)
{
var behavior = $find('DynamicPopulateExtender1');
if (behavior)
{
behavior.populate(value);
}
FUNCION DEL WEBSERVICE EN LA CUAL PUEDE SER TAN SIMPLE O COMPLEJA COMO UNO LA REQUIERA INCLUSO CON LLAMADO A SQL
public static string ValidaDato(string contextKey)
{
string resultado = "";
try
{
resultado = "HOLA MUNDO" + contextKey;
}
catch (System.Exception excep)
{
resultado = excep.Message;
}
return resultado;
}
}
Última edición por HalconDivino; 08/09/2011 a las 18:13 |